Instruments Mechanic Maintenance B shift
Entry level job in Madison, NE
Certain roles at Tyson require background checks. If you are offered a position that requires a background check you will be provided additional documentation to complete once an offer has been extended
.
Job Details:
Job Description
Positions are responsible for keeping machinery running to maintain continuous production. This includes repairing and maintaining the operating conditions of the machinery and Industrial equipment used in the pork processing industry, troubleshooting problems that occur in the day- to-day operation of the facility. The position requires performing work involving hydraulics, electrical, plumbing, conveyor maintenance, 3-phase wiring, AC DC control wiring, welding and pneumatic systems. The Team Member will also set up, adjust and break down production line machinery and complete daily documentation that is required. Occasional lifting from 0-61lbs.
For the safety of our team members, for certain skilled positions a HAZMAT and/or PFT (Pulmonary Function Test) will be required to pass to be considered in that department. For the following skilled positions Instruments, Projects, Chillers/Engine Room /Refrigeration, PSM Coordinator; mechanical knowledge/background is preferred.
Must be available to work all shifts, including weekends, holidays and available for overtime.
Must be able to communicate effectively with all team members and management to resolve mechanical failures as well as be able to read manuals in order to repair equipment safely.
Must be willing and able to climb ladders and work from elevated platforms.
Must be willing and able to stand/walk 12-hour shifts on hard floors. Must be willing and able to work in all environments of our processing facility such as Harvest, Cut Converting, Rendering and Load-out freezer areas with temperatures ranging from -30 to +90 degrees.
Applicant must have previous maintenance experience in two of the following areas:
• Electrical troubleshooting and maintenance, to include 3ph wiring, 460 or 220 v, 110 vac wiring, 24 v wiring, PLCs with emphasis on I/O. Types of I/O sensors, such as PT'S / CT'S / 4-20 ma / low voltage / RTD's and Thermocouples / how they work and how to troubleshoot.
• Welding to include AC/DC stick / Mig / Tig / Torch brazing. Understand how to set the welder and why?
• Plumbing to include PVC / CPVC / Compression / Flare / Sweating of copper / Threaded pipe. Know the difference and have basic knowledge of how each process works.
• Conveyor / Auger maintenance
• Pneumatic controls and air tools.
• Hydraulics with basic understanding of controls and control valves and how they work.

Auto-ApplyFabricator I
Entry level job in Snyder, NE
Apply now " Fabricator I Company: REV Group, Inc. Work Hours: Mon-Thu 6a-4:30p, 30 min lunch Additional Locations: Smeal, a REV Group brand, is recognized as a premier manufacturer, inventor, and innovator of custom fire apparatus. The company offers a full line of custom and commercial pumpers, rescue pumpers, aerial ladders, and urban interface vehicles. Smeal is committed to leading the industry in high-quality fire apparatus, delivery times and customer experience. Smeal sells its products worldwide and is based in Snyder, NE.
Smeal Apparatus is part of the larger REV Group (NYSE: REVG), a leading manufacturer of specialty vehicles for the fire & emergency and recreation markets. REV Group's extensive vehicle line-up includes models such as ambulances, fire trucks, terminal trucks, RV's and much more. Our 5,000+ employees continuously demonstrate their commitment to building innovative and reliable vehicles that our customers can depend on whether for a family trip across the U.S. or when responding to an emergency. Rev Group is a veteran friendly employer and hires over 200 veterans and or those transferring out of the military each year.
Essential Job Functions:
* Follow standard operating procedures as well as written and verbal orders and instructions in English.
* Lift up to 40 lbs. and be in good physical condition. Standing, bending, climbing, crawling, and lying on hard surfaces as well as upper body and back strength required.
* Follow all company policies and procedures as stated in the company policy and safety manual including wearing safety glasses, safety toed footwear, hardhats, and other required PPE per area.
* Able to work in a noisy environment.
* Work overtime as needed.
* Actively pursue cost reduction measures.
* Perform all assigned tasks within specific time limits and company standards.
* Must be able to read a tape measure.
* Must comply with all safety regulations regarding the work area, the product and equipment. Recognize and report all safety discrepancies to your supervisor.
* Willing to develop a thorough knowledge of all aspects of this field including products, options, & uses.
* Ability to learn how to read and understand simple blue prints.
* Ability & willingness to be cross-trained in respective departments.
* Able to learn about parts and where they are used as well as the number required per assigned task.
* Communicate with department leaders when items run low in order to restock/reorder parts.
* Possess some prior experience from outside of the company or has mastered all the required skills at the previous level in order to advance.
* Willingness to share department and company knowledge as needed.
* Ability to write down information for future reference.
* Ability to become a certified welder.
Daily Functions:
* Execute proper fixturing and set up.
* Perform metal arc welding of ladder components, torque box, and miscellaneous parts as well as required sanding per company standards and quality cosmetic appearance. This includes inside of torque box and body compartments which may cause awkward positioning.
* Build from blue prints, shop orders, etc.
* Use hand tools, sanders, and grinders and operate plasma cutter, torch, shear bar-angle, & iron saw
* Perform acceptable welds in qualified process and position under supervision and guidance of a Welder II or higher.
* Willingness to learn NDT testing acceptability standards.
* Sand and grind welds and/or parts.
* Ability to identify different types of welding styles.
* Identify and place parts in designated areas.
* Ability to correctly set welder for weld type.
* Ability to do a rough set on welder settings.
* Ability to perform tack welding.
* Ability to read weld symbols and specifications on blue prints.
* Understand and adhere to excellent quality work standards.
Required Tests:
* Must be able to pass a Flat Weld Test in aluminum and steel.
Potential Hazards:
* Eye injuries & exposure to ultra violet rays: welding can cause damage to eyes. Required to wear an approved helmet with a lens tinted to 10 or darker per OSHA standards, or an electronic lens set to at least 10 when welding. Eye protection and face shield must be worn when sanding to prevent eye injury.
* Burns: wear PPE when welding to protect against burns.
* Trips & falls: ensure all air hoses and obstacles are kept clear of aisles.
* Heavy lifting: ask co-worker for help or use a crane or forklift operator when lifting objects over 75 lbs.
* Air quality: wear respirator when in close quarters due to gases from welding, if needed.

CDL Driver - Tender Truck
Entry level job in Schuyler, NE
Job DescriptionSalary:
FRONTIER COOPERATIVE is an agriculture leader in Nebraska providing grain, agronomy, feed and energy products and services to our customers. At Frontier, we have a long-standing tradition of successful partnerships with our customers by managing our business with the highest integrity and quality while being responsible stewards in our communities.
We are now hiring a Tender Truck Driver for our Schuyler, NE location! This position is being offered as full-time with benefits.
A Tender Truck Driver is responsible for operating company-licensed commercial vehicles in a safe, effective and efficient manner while delivering dry/liquid fertilizers and chemicals, in a manner that will ensure excellent customer service and standards are met. To ensure success in this position, Frontier Cooperative provides industry-specific training and tools necessary to obtain the proper credentials and certifications required for this position.
Essential duties:
Requires either a CDL Class A or Class B, with proper endorsements, to operate the tender semi-trucks or straight trucks to transport dry and liquid fertilizer or anhydrous ammonia nurse trailers to producers fields.
Depending on company location, may assist with the loading of chemicals manually or through the company software system according to specifications given by Ag Advisors; loads chemicals into containers by connecting hoses and operates the transfer system; when transfer is complete, secures vehicle for transport; receives customer location maps and delivery instructions; retains load ticket at all times that describe the chemical(s) being transported.
Delivers product to AG Equipment Operators at producers fields; prepares truck for product transfer; connects hoses to applicator machinery, operate pumps to transfer the product; clears hose lines when transfer is completed and secure hoses to truck; if needed, submit load ticket to operator regarding product delivered and returns to chemical plant for new product load.
Job skills and requirements:
Customer service; transportation and delivery of agricultural products, manual labor, safety protocols, time management, problem solving, and analyzing information.
Safely operate commercial vehicles and agricultural equipment, pneumatic, bench and hand tools, computers, company software programs, and material handling equipment such as forklifts, power loaders, boom trucks, skid steers, etc.
Interpret a variety of instructions and work orders furnished in written, oral, or electronic form; read and interpret gauges, dials and meters, directional and plot maps, various safety rules, state and federal DOT commercial driving regulations, weigh, load, and delivery tickets, hazmat shipping papers, and standard operating and maintenance manuals and/or instructions.
Able to perform and record Pre and Post-Trip Inspections, mileage and fuel reports, complete work orders and general correspondence.
Perform basic math computations. Such as; add, subtract, multiply, divide, proportions, percentages, and volume
